Extjs4.1+desktop+SSH2 搭建环境 项目能跑起来
linux开发感觉可能就是日常办公的时候,用别的软件会有问题,java开发还是没什么区别的,换回window开发;
push 它;


每次看到右上那红红的叉,我还以为又出错了;
这个项目用resin,下载之;貌似有ecipse插件:
http://www.caucho.com/resin-4.0/admin/resin-eclipse-support.xtp
eclipse管理的项目提交到git的时候,如果不吧.project、.classpath和setting提交,项目导入的时候导入不了;
这个项目要用oracle,那就安装一个12c;




这什么意思?未找到dr0ulib.sql.sbs
由于只解压了第一个,没解压第二个造成的,导致文件不完整。
重新来过;

喂,停在这里好久了啊;
有窗口在后台,用Alt + tab 切换一下试试。
果然;
下载客户端:
http://www.oracle.com/technetwork/database/features/instant-client/index-097480.html
instantclient-basic-windows.x64-12.1.0.2.0.zip

那就装32位的吧;
instantclient-basic-nt-12.1.0.2.0.zip

这回正常了;
这重新装oracle变成了dbhome_2,这,有强迫症怎么办;

没配对吗;
删掉oracle重试;

是否继续,得打中文“是”,呵呵;
listener.ora和tnsnames.ora复制到instantclient_12_1文件夹下;
32位客户端PLSQL连接64位数据库;
执行报错:
create user desktop
identified by "desktop"
default tablespace desktop
temporary tablespace temp
profile default
quota unlimited on desktop;
oracle12创建用户错误ORA-65096: 公用用户名或角色名无效
oracle12C 创建用户时好像需要加 c##username,
Oracle 12c:
create tablespace desktop
datafile 'D:/oracle/oradata/desktop.dbf' size 10m autoextend on next 5m maxsize unlimited
extent management local;
--重启数据库
--创建用户
create user c##desktop
identified by desktop
default tablespace DESKTOP
temporary tablespace temp
profile default
quota unlimited on DESKTOP;
--授权
grant connect to c##desktop;
grant exp_full_database to c##desktop;
grant imp_full_database to c##desktop;
启动应用服务:
ORA-28040: No matching authentication protocol
问题
因为客户端程序比较老还是用的jdk1.5,所以不能使用Oracle 12c自带的JDBC驱动,但是在使用老的JDBC驱动连接Oracle的时候出现下面的错误
error:
ORA-28040: No matching authentication protocol
解决办法
编辑 $ORACLE_HOME/network/admin/sqlnet.ora文件,如果没有可以创建一个新的,加入下面的参数
SQLNET.ALLOWED_LOGON_VERSION=8
ORA-01017: invalid username/password; logon denied
用户名换:jdbc.username=C##DESKTOP
http://localhost:8080/desktop/
连接有空白,后台没报错,是资源路径问题;
resin.xml加上配置,修改为默认项目;
<host id="" root-directory=".">
<!--
- webapps can be overridden/extended in the resin.xml
-->
<web-app id="/" document-directory="D:\J2EE\resin-4.0.44\webapps\desktop"></web-app>
</host>
Extjs4.1+desktop+SSH2 搭建环境 项目能跑起来的更多相关文章
- Liunx开发(Extjs4.1+desktop+SSH2超强视频教程实践)(2)
然后装eclipse: 为啥默认是搜狗导航: java还没装呢: http://www.oracle.com/technetwork/java/javase/downloads/jdk8-downlo ...
- Liunx开发(Extjs4.1+desktop+SSH2超强视频教程实践)(1)
下周一出差宁波了,周六日就折腾点视频: 跟着视频教程开发,不过开发环境换linux,上月找工作,某个吉祥物是松鼠的公司要求用linux开发,没用过的,连面试机会都不给,极其高冷:好吧,咱就试试,用li ...
- Extjs4.1+desktop+SSH2 定义程序入口
app.js定义程序入口: MainController.js: 加载控制器: 外部组件引用入口loader.js 时间组件 静态变量组件: 引入comm.js index.jsp 验证打印 comm ...
- 内网 Ubuntu 20.04 搭建 docusaurus 项目(或前端项目)的环境(mobaxterm、tigervnc、nfs、node)
内网 Ubuntu 20.04 搭建 docusaurus 项目(或前端项目)的环境 背景 内网开发机是 win7,只能安装 node 14 以下,而 spug 的文档项目采用的是 Facebook ...
- Ubuntu Desktop基本办公环境搭建
Ubuntu Desktop基本办公环境搭建 一如前面所强调的, linux系统是面向开发人员友好的,而对office办公人员并不友好 . 如果是重度的office办公需求人员,不建议使用linux ...
- 搭建PhoneCat项目的开发与测试环境
AngularJS官方网站提供了一个用于学习的示例项目:PhoneCat.这是一个Web应用,用户可以浏览一些Android手机,了解它们的详细信息,并进行搜索和排序操作. 获取源代码 PhoneCa ...
- 手把手教你用webpack3搭建react项目(开发环境和生产环境)(一)
开发环境和生产环境整个配置源码在github上,源码地址:github-webpack-react 如果觉得有帮助,点个Star谢谢!! (一)是开发环境,(二)是生产环境. 一.首先创建packag ...
- 搭建vue项目环境
前言 在开发本项目之前,我对vue,react,angular等框架了解,仅限于知道它们是什么框架,他们的核心是什么,但是并没有实际使用过(angular 1.0版本用过,因为太难用,所以对这类框架都 ...
- VUE环境项目搭建以及简单的运行例子
1.打开cmd命令窗口,node-v和npm-v可以查看相应的安装版本信息. 2.使用一下命令全局安装vue-cli. 1)npm install -g vue-cli 2)如果使用淘宝镜像,则是 ...
随机推荐
- 使用shell脚本分析Nagios的status.dat文件
前言 Nagios的安装和配置以及批量添加监控服务器在我前面的文章中已经讲的很详细了. 我们知道,Nagios的网页控制页面(一般为http://nagio.domain.com/nagios)里可以 ...
- springboot Consider defining a bean of type 'xxx' in your configuration
这个错误是service的bean注入失败,主要是Application位置不对,要保证项目中的类在Application启动服务器类的下一级目录,如图:
- Click: 命令行工具神器
Click是一个Python用来快速实现命令行应用程序的包,主要优势表现在以下三点: 任意嵌套命令 自动生成帮助页 自动运行时lazy加载子命令 示例程序: import click @click.c ...
- Web攻击技术---OWASP top
整理OWASP top 10 部分内容,方便日后查看.想深入了解的,请移步参考中的网站. OWASP Top 10 注入 将不受信任的数据作为命令或者查询的一部分发送到解析器时,会发生诸如SQL注入. ...
- Ubuntu下rsyslog审计用户bash操作命令、收集、写入MySQL
服务端 2台服务端:10.25.109.64.10.45.18.133 1.rsyslog最新版本安装 sudo add-apt-repository ppa:adiscon/v8-stable su ...
- Luogu P1967 货车运输 倍增+最大生成树
看见某大佬在做,决定补一发题解$qwq$ 首先跑出最大生成树(注意有可能不连通),然后我们要求的就是树上两点间路径上的最小边权. 我们用倍增的思路跑出来$w[u][j]$,表示$u$与的它$2^j$的 ...
- Jenkins之自动触发部署之插件Generic Webhook Trigger Plugin
一.安装好插件 二.构建触发器会出现设置trigger的入口 三.设置的两个部分 第一: Jenkins的这个触发器,这里主要是接受post数据.其中Post content parameters是用 ...
- (转)KICKSTART无人值守安装
KICKSTART无人值守安装 导言 作为中小公司的运维,经常会遇到一些机械式的重复工作,例如:有时公司同时上线几十甚至上百台服务器,而且需要我们在短时间内完成系统安装. 常规的办法有什么? 光盘安装 ...
- ZK配置文件
The number of milliseconds of each tick, 最小时间单位,很多运行时的时间 #间隔都是使用tickTime的倍数来表示的,例如initLimit=10就是tick ...
- Jmeter-性能测试工具
0.概念和备注 //基本使用流程 测试计划-->右键 添加-> Threads(Users) --> 选择线程组 -->线程组-->右键 添加 --> Sample ...